Sonic Super Special 15 is the fifthteenth and final issue of the Sonic Super Special miniseries; it was published in November 2000 and features the stories Naugus Games and Sonic Spin City.
Background Information
- It's stated that Sonic had just gotten Mobotropolis back from Robotnik in Naugus Games, meaning it takes place between the events of Issue 75 and Issue 76. This creates a plot hole, however, since only days pass between the events of the aforementioned issues.
- The Naugus Games story is rather infamous for its poor art, with many pages either being completely back or covered in snow.
- Naugus Games was remade in the Free Comic Book Day 2011 story Rematch, officially making the original version non-canonical.
- Ian Flynn stated that the original story would not be included in any Sonic Selects graphic novel, likely due to the reasons above.
- Sonic Spin City is a parody of Frank Miller's Sin City, and is the only story in this issue to be republished (Sonic Archives 17).
